Rotel Pasta with Ground Beef

Rotel Pasta with Ground Beef: Creamy Comfort in Minutes

Creamy Rotel Pasta with Ground Beef is a weeknight favorite that combines flavors of cream cheese and zesty tomatoes for a comforting meal in under 30 minutes.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: American
Calories: 550

Ingredients
  

For the Pasta
  • 8 ounces elbow macaroni Cook until al dente
For the Sauce
  • 1 pound ground beef Can be substituted with turkey or a plant-based option
  • 1 can (10 ounces) diced tomatoes with green chilies (Rotel) Adds zesty flavor
  • 8 ounces cream cheese Softened for smooth mixing
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ese Swap with pepper jack for a spicy twist
  • 1 cup beef broth Use low-sodium for a healthier option
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der Use fresh garlic for more flavor
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• salt and pepper To taste
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il For browning the beef
  • fresh cilantro or parsley For garnish (optional)

Equipment

  • Large pot
  • Colander
  • Wooden spoon

Method
 

Step‑by‑Step Instructions
  1.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Add elbow macaroni and cook for 7-8 minutes, or until al dente. Drain and set aside.
  2. In the same pot,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add ground beef, browning it for 5-7 minutes until no longer pink. Drain excess fat.
  3. Add garlic powder and onion powder to the beef, along with salt and pepper. Stir and cook for an additional minute.
  4. Stir in Rotel tomatoes, softened cream cheese, and beef broth. Cook until cream cheese melts and the mixture is smooth.
  5. Fold in the cooked macaroni and sprinkle in shredded cheddar cheese, mixing until melted and creamy.
  6. Serve hot, garnished with fresh cilantro or parsley if desired.

Notes

For best results, ensure the cream cheese is fully softened before mixing. Adjust seasonings for personal taste.
